Classifying Organisms.
Let’s use the common house cat as an example…
Felis domesticus.The first part of the name is called….Genus
First name (always capital case) refers to similar closely related organisms
Classifying Organisms.
Continuing Felis domesticusThe second name is the……. Species
A group of organisms that can mate and produce fertile offspring in nature.
Lower case
Classifying Organisms.
So, in the case of Felis domesticus (the common house cat) Felis is the genus and domesticus is the species.
You can tell the house cat is related to the puma because the puma’s scientific name is Felis concolor.
Both from the same genus.

The Three Domains of Life
Archaea: Prokaryotes, many are "extremophiles“
• include inhabitants of some of the most extreme environments on the planet. Some live near rift vents in the deep sea at temperatures well over 100 degrees Centigrade. Others live in hot springs or in extremely alkaline or acid waters. They have been found thriving inside the digestive tracts of cows, termites, and marine life where they produce methane

The Kingdoms
6. AnimalsAll animals are multi-cellular,heterotrophic
aerobic, eukaryotes. Lots of cells. Must eat other organisms. Need air. Has a Nucleus in each cell.
Animals
Animals are divided into about 35 phyla. Remember….Kings Play Cards On Fat Green Stools.
One of the biggest separation occurs between… Invertebrates
Animals without a backbone
Vertebrates Animals with a backbone.
